When he finally reaches the player\u2019s name, the fans scream it right along with him.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>\u201cO! &#8230; G! &#8230; AN-UN-OBY!!!!\u201d<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div>\n<div><\/div>\n<p><span>Early Thursday morning, fans again chanted Anunoby\u2019s name, this time in a bar outside the arena as they celebrated one of the most memorable moments in Knicks history.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>Anunoby\u2019s tip-in with 1.2 seconds remaining in Game 4 put the Knicks on the verge of a title and moved him into the discussion for NBA Finals MVP.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>Anunoby is not the kind of player who usually wins awards, and he might be the least-known of the Knicks\u2019 starters. A stunning Game 4 comeback has them one win away.<\/div>\n<p><span>Anunoby is the only player on the Knicks\u2019 postseason roster who has won a ring, but he was injured and didn\u2019t play for the Raptors in the 2019 NBA Finals. But there\u2019s no way New York would have a chance at its first championship since 1973 if he wasn\u2019t front and center now.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>From scoring to stopping, Anunoby might to be asked to do more than any Knicks player. He not only finished with 33 points in Game 4 but also made the biggest defensive play of the game when he chased down De\u2019Aaron Fox to block his shot with 11 seconds left and the Spurs leading 106-105.<\/span><\/p>\n<div><\/div>\n<p><span>Knicks center Karl-Anthony Towns said that\u2019s what he expects from a player who seems to save his best for the biggest moments.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>\u201cEvery time I talk to him, I say, I already know what OG Anunoby is going to do in the fourth quarter, and he did exactly what I thought he would do,\u201d Towns said. \u201cHe gave us a chance to win, and that\u2019s all you could ask for from the best two-way player in the NBA.\u201d<\/span><\/p>\n<p>Read more <a href=\"https:\/\/bostonrelocationinsider.com\/?p=2541\">Game 67: Rangers at Red Sox lineups and notes<\/a><\/p>\n<p><span>The Knicks couldn\u2019t believe Anunoby was only voted to the All-Defensive second team, certain there aren\u2019t five better defenders in the NBA. It was those defensive skills that made him most attractive when the Knicks acquired him from the Raptors in 2023, giving up two of their most promising players on a developing team in RJ Barrett and Immanuel Quickley.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>Anunoby was also known as a reliable 3-point shooter from the corners, and he made one as time expired to give the Raptors a victory over the Celtics in the 2020 playoffs. He hardly celebrated after the shot went through, just as he was one of the few people inside Madison Square Garden who appeared completely calm after his basket in Game 4.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>\u201cJust, the game wasn\u2019t over,\u201d Anunoby explained. \u201cI looked up to see the time. If it would have been 0:00, I would have been more excited, but it was just 1.2 left. So just knowing, get a stop now, just stay with it, staying present, not getting too happy because the game is not over yet.\u201d<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>Anunoby is averaging 23.8 points in the series, shooting 58 percent from the field and 55.6 percent from 3-point range. He finished 10 for 15 in Game 4, including 7 for 9 behind the arc.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>When Anunoby limped off the court with a hamstring injury late in the Knicks\u2019 victory over the 76ers in Game 2 of the second round, there was concern this run could be in jeopardy just as it was picking up steam. When Anunoby was hurt at the same time in the 2024 playoffs, the Knicks blew a 2-0 lead against the Pacers and ultimately lost the series in Game 7, when Anunoby gamely tried to return after missing four games but it was clear he could hardly move and was yanked after five minutes.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>This injury was not as bad. Helped by extended time off when the Knicks swept the 76ers, Anunoby was able to return in time for the start of the Eastern Conference finals.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>Having him on the floor now \u2014 and soaring through the air in the final seconds of Game 4 \u2014 could be what it takes to end a 53-year title drought.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span>\u201cOG, he\u2019s been amazing since he\u2019s got here,\u201d fellow forward Josh Hart said. \u201cThis whole playoff run, he\u2019s been amazing on both ends of the ball.
